#919834 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#919834 is composed of 56.9% red, 59.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 64.2 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 40%. #919834 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#233100.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#919834 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#919834 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#919834 has RGB values of R:145, G:152,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9541684.

Shades and Tints of #919834
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060602 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#919834
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696963 is the less saturated color, while #b9c705 is the most saturated one.
